Abstract:
A CNC lathe provided with two opposed head stocks (2a, 2b), two turret type tool rests (3a, 3b), and a slanting base (1), the first head stock (2a) being fixed to the base (1), the second head stock (2b) being provided so that it can be moved and positioned in the direction of a main shaft only, two tool rests (3a, 3b) being arranged at the back of the head stocks (2a, 2b). A CNC lathe having the above-mentioned construction, in which each head stock is provided independently with a main shaft motor (21), a mechanically engageable and disengageable main shaft indexing driving unit (23), and main shaft side and indexing driving unit side encoders (27, 26), adapted to carry out a phase matching operation by rotating an indexing motor (40) on the basis of a phase difference detected by the encoders when the main shaft indexing driving unit (23) is connected to a main shaft (11) and when transfer of a work (16) is made between the main shafts (2a, 2b). A CNC lathe having the above-mentioned construction and provided with a synchronizing control unit (53) adapted to segment the output pulses from the encoders (27) on the main shafts on a minute time basis and correct a speed command in accordance with the magnitude thereof. According to the present invention, a CNC lathe having a first head stock of a high rigidity, capable of using a bar feeder of a conventional construction and having an improved efficiency in carrying out a work machining operation including an indexing machining operation using two main shafts an improved efficiency of machining a bar material which requires a cutting-off when the transfer of the work is made between the main shafts can be obtained.

Abstract:
The present invention relates to a method and a device in the chip-removing machining of a work-piece (3) by means of a rotatable tool (4) with an arbor arranged in a headstock. The tool (4) is displaceable both in an axial direction towards and away from the work-piece (3) and in a plane substantially perpendicular to the arbor. Arranged around a machining point (2) is an enclosure (1), which has a first opening (6), designed to bear tightly against the work-piece (3) around the machining point (2). A second opening (9) in the enclosure (1) is made in a wall (8) substantially perpendicular to the arbor and is designed, during machining, to bear tightly against a plane plate (10) arranged behind the tool (4) and around the headstock, substantially perpendicular to the arbor, so that during machining there is a substantially enclosed space in the area around the tool (4) and the machining point (2). The device comprises means of delivering cutting fluid to the machining point (2) and the enclosure (1) has an outlet opening (12) through which chips that are removed are evacuated from the enclosure (1) by means of the cutting fluid delivered.
Abstract:
The invention concerns a rotary device (R) for changing parts to be machined by a machine-tool (M), consisting of a supporting table (100) which, comprising at least two pallet supports (110 and 120) arranged at regular angular interval for receiving each a part-carrying pallet (210 and 220), is mounted rotating (arrow F) between the machining station (300) of the machine-tool (M) and the post for supplying (400) part-carrying pallets (210 and 220) arranged opposite said machining station (300). This device is characterised in that said supporting table (100) is mounted pivoting about its central axis (Y) and tilting between a horizontal position and an inclined position (angle "a") relative to the hor izontal plane. The invention is useful for changing parts for a machine-tool.
Abstract:
The tool has a tool shank (which may be hollow) (14), whilst the machine spindle has a connecting sleeve (20) containing a recess (18) to accommodate the tool shank. A clamping mechanism (22) is located in the area between the tool shank (14) and the connecting sleeve (20). This mechanism has at least one clamping element (24''), with radial movement, which acts as a wedge drive, providing axial clamping movement between the tool shank (14) and connecting sleeve (20). The clamping mechanism comprises an actuating nut (26), which screws onto an exterior thread (28) on the connecting sleeve (20) and is coaxial in relation to the spindle axis. During the clamping procedure, the axial movement of the actuating nut can be converted into the radial movement of the clamping element (24''), with the help of at least one connecting link (30'').
